Ramkrishna Forgings Limited (Company), one of the leading suppliers of rolled, forged, and machined products on Friday announced that the resolution plan submitted by the Company for the acquisition of ACIL Limited has been approved by the National Company Law Tribunal, New Delhi, the company announced through an exchange filing.
About ACIL Limited
ACIL Limited is engaged in the manufacturing of high precision engineering automotive components, It majorly manufactures crankshafts for tractors, HCV, LCV as well as two wheelers. Besides, the company also manufactures connecting rods, steering knuckles and hubs. lts manufacturing facility is located in Gurugram, Haryana.
